8. Cash Access Card; Account Access; Limitations
Each time you use your Card, you authorize us to reduce the value available on your Card by the amount of the transaction and applicable fees. Your Card cannot be redeemed for cash except where required by law. You are not allowed to exceed the available amount in your Card Account through an individual transaction or a series of transactions and our policy is to decline to authorize any transaction for which you have insufficient funds in your Card Account. Nevertheless, if a transaction exceeds the balance of the funds available on in your Card Account, you shall remain fully liable to us for the amount of the transaction and any applicable fees. We may deduct any amount that you owe us from any current or future funds associated with this or any other Card you activate or maintain. We also reserve the right to cancel this Card and close your Card Account should you create one or more negative balances with your Card.

You may not use your Card for any illegal transactions, online gambling, or escort services. We may refuse to process any Card transaction that we believe may violate the terms of this Agreement or applicable law. You may use your Card to: (i) withdraw cash from your Card Account and (ii) make in-person and non-Card-present purchases.

Your card may be used to obtain cash from an Automated Teller Machine (“ATM”) subject to the fees and limits set forth in this Agreement.

Some merchants do not allow cardholders to conduct split transactions where you would use the Card as partial payment for goods and services and pay the remainder of the balance with another form of legal tender. If you wish to conduct a split transaction and it is permitted by the merchant, you must tell the merchant to charge only the exact amount of funds available on the Card to the Card. You must then arrange to pay the difference using another payment method. Some merchants may require payment for the remaining balance in cash. If you fail to inform the merchant that you would like to complete a split transaction prior to swiping your Card, your Card is likely to be declined. At the time of each purchase using the Card, you may be asked to sign a receipt for the transaction. The dollar amount of the purchase will be deducted from the value associated with the Card.

You do not have the right to stop payment on any purchase transaction originated by use of your Card, except as otherwise provided herein. With certain types of purchases (such as those made at restaurants, hotels, or similar purchases), your Card may be “preauthorized” for an amount greater than the transaction amount to cover gratuity or incidental expenses. Any preauthorization amount will place a “hold” on your available funds until the merchant sends us the final payment amount of your purchase. It may take up to thirty (30) days for the hold to be removed. During this time, you will not have access to preauthorized amounts. Once the final payment amount is received, the preauthorization amount on hold will be removed. If you authorize a transaction and then fail to make a purchase of that item as planned, the approval may result in a hold for that amount of funds.

Foreign Transaction Fee: If you obtain your funds (or make a purchase) in a currency or country other than the currency or country in which your Card was issued (“Foreign Transaction”), you will be charged a fee on the total amount of the transaction in U.S. Dollars. For Foreign Currency Conversion fee, see paragraph below in this Agreement captioned “Fee Schedule”. The card association may consider transactions occurring in U.S. territories to be Foreign Transactions, so transactions originating from these locations may be subject to a Foreign Transaction Fee. If the Foreign Transaction results in a credit due to a return, we will not refund any Foreign Transaction Fee that may have been charged on your original purchase.

Currency Conversion: If you make a Foreign Transaction, the amount deducted from your funds will be converted by the network or card association that processes the transaction into an amount in the currency of your Card. Mastercard currently uses a conversion rate that is either: (i) selected from the range of rates available in wholesale currency markets (which may vary from the rate the association itself receives), or (ii) the government-mandated rate in effect for the applicable central processing date. The conversion rate selected by the network is independent of the Foreign Transaction Fee that we charge as compensation for our services.

21. Lost or Stolen Cards; Your Liability for Unauthorized Transfers
Contact us at once by calling 1-877-919-1669 if you believe your Card has been lost or stolen. You must provide your name, address, Card Account number, CID, and other details as requested by us to replace your Card. We cannot assist you if you do not have the Card Account number or do not provide us with the requested information. If we issue a replacement Card, the replacement Card will have a value equal to the Available Balance on the Card at the time you notified us of the loss or theft. Any Available Balance will be temporarily unavailable until you activate your replacement Card. NO REFUNDS WILL BE PROVIDED FOR AMOUNTS DEBITED FROM THE LOST OR STOLEN CARD BEFORE YOU NOTIFY US. You acknowledge that purchases made the Card, are similar to those made with cash. You cannot “stop payment” or “lodge a billing dispute” on such transactions. Any problems or disputes you may have regarding a purchase should be addressed directly with the merchant.
